Our mission

The Victoria Park South Perth and Districts RSL Sub Branch is a not-for-profit, ACNC-registered charity, affiliated with RSLWA. Since 2000, our mission has been to care for the welfare of retired and serving Defence members and their families, to commemorate the service and sacrifice of Australian servicemen and women, and to foster comradeship in our community — supported by welfare and advocacy work, commemorative services, and our annual Poppy Day appeal.

Our Purpose

Care, comradeship and remembrance

Established in 2000, our Sub Branch carries forward the enduring mission of the Returned & Services League: to look after those who have served our nation, and the families who have stood beside them. We provide welfare support, advocacy, social connection and a place of belonging for veterans of all ages and conflicts.

We also keep the spirit of remembrance alive in our community — commemorating the service and sacrifice of Australian servicemen and women, and passing that legacy on to the next generation.

  • Welfare support and pension & entitlement advocacy for veterans
  • Comradeship, wellbeing and social connection
  • Commemorative services including ANZAC Day and Remembrance Day
  • The annual Poppy Day appeal supporting veteran welfare

Transparency & Accountability

A small Sub Branch, fully accountable

The Victoria Park South Perth and Districts RSL Sub Branch is a small, volunteer-driven charity registered with the Australian Charities and Not-for-profits Commission (ACNC) and affiliated with RSLWA. We report to the regulator each year, and our welfare work and Poppy Day funds are overseen by an elected volunteer committee — no part of our income provides private benefit to any individual.
